    ๐Ÿ“‚ Why Does DAM System Migration Bring Risks?

    Many managers imagine DAM migration as "moving files from one folder to another." But when a renowned skincare brand's marketing director faced 500,000 product images and 3 years of marketing materials, she realized it was more like "performing heart surgery without stopping the heartbeat."

    The reality's complexity lies in: million-level assets, distributed team collaboration processes, and high sensitivity of brand assets.

    Common Risk Categories:

    • Data Integrity Risks: Tags and metadata fail to transfer completely, causing material retrieval difficulties
    • Permission Security Risks: Role mismatches between old and new systems may lead to core asset leaks
    • Business Continuity Risks: Critical marketing campaigns or product launches forced to delay

    Case Scenario: A mid-sized fashion e-commerce company changed DAM systems on the eve of Singles' Day. Due to lack of permission mapping planning, the design team couldn't access brand logos and product galleries during the critical 48 hours of promotional poster creation. The campaign launch was delayed 3 days, resulting in direct revenue loss of 2 million yuan. This "painful lesson" made them realize: DAM migration isn't a technical issue, but a strategic decision crucial to enterprise survival.


    ๐Ÿ›ก๏ธ How Should Enterprises Identify Potential Migration Risks Early?

    Successful migration begins with deep "enterprise health checks." Like an experienced surgeon who must fully understand patient conditions before surgery, enterprises need 360-degree diagnosis of existing digital asset ecosystems.

    Core Risk Identification Steps:

    1. Comprehensive Asset Inventory
    • Count material volume, format distribution, metadata completeness
    • Identify orphaned files and duplicate assets
    • Assess historical version management status
    1. Deep Business Process Diagnosis
    • Map each department's DAM dependency level
    • Analyze high-frequency usage scenarios and time points
    • Identify critical business windows
    1. Complete Permission Architecture Review
    • Prioritize high-sensitivity core assets
    • Map cross-departmental collaboration permission relationships
    • Identify temporary access and external collaboration needs


    Quick Risk Identification Points:

    • Inventory total assets and format complexity
    • Identify business-critical dependency nodes
    • Map existing permission architecture vulnerabilities
    • Assess team technical acceptance

    ๐Ÿ”„ What Executable Risk Control Strategies Exist?

    Different-sized enterprises should adopt different strategies.

    Small Enterprise Migration Strategy

    Core Pain Points:

    Limited budget, scarce technical resources, but extremely high business continuity requirements.

    Solutions:

    • Progressive Migration: Prioritize migrating core materials with highest daily usage frequency
    • Cloud Security Assurance: Leverage SaaS platform enterprise-grade encrypted transmission without additional security infrastructure investment
    • Simplified Permission Management: Quick configuration through role templates, avoiding complex personalized settings

    Success Practice:

    A startup completed migration of 80,000 materials in just 5 working days with only 3 employees. The key was categorizing materials by usage frequency into three priority levels, ensuring core assets functioned normally from day one.


    Medium-Large Enterprise Migration Strategy

    Core Challenges:

    Complex multi-department coordination, massive historical data, extremely high security and compliance requirements.

    Solutions:

    • Dual-System Parallel Operation: Run new and old systems simultaneously for 2-4 weeks ensuring seamless transition
    • Department-by-Department Gradual Switching: Start pilots with departments having lower DAM dependency
    • Permission Mapping Project: Create detailed cross-departmental permission correspondence tables preventing information leak risks
    • Automation Tool Enhancement: Utilize AI auto-tagging and version management to handle massive historical data

    Enterprise Risk Control Points:

    • Establish dual-system parallel buffer period
    • Create detailed permission mapping plans
    • Set department-by-department gradual switching schedule
    • Configure real-time monitoring and alert mechanisms

    ๐Ÿ“Š How to Ensure Business Continuity During Migration?

    "Migration cannot become an excuse for business standstill." This was a FMCG brand CMO's opening statement at the migration project kickoff. Their challenge: how to complete the system switch of 300,000 materials without affecting daily marketing activities?

    Zero-Interruption Assurance Methods:

    1.Establish Temporary Digital Asset Buffer Zone

    Set up temporary mirror libraries ensuring teams can access critical materials without obstacles during migration. Like building temporary walkways for pedestrians during construction.

    2.Critical Asset Priority Migration

    • First Priority: Materials for ongoing marketing activities
    • Second Priority: Soon-to-be-released product materials
    • Third Priority: Historical archives and backup materials

    3.Real-time Business Monitoring System

    Leverage MuseDAM data analytics to monitor team usage in real-time, identifying and resolving access anomalies immediately.

    โœ… How to Continuously Optimize and Monitor After Migration?

    "Migration completion isn't the endpoint, but the starting point of a new era in digital asset management." As a global FMCG brand's digitalization leader said, the real challenge lies in how to make the new system continuously generate value.

    Continuous Optimization Measures:

    • Regular Permission Audits: Prevent excessive permission exposure
    • Version Rollback: Use version management to prevent losses from operational errors
    • AI Auto-Tagging: Ensure search efficiency, reduce subsequent maintenance costs
    • Team Retrospectives: Form migration standards for future expansion or upgrades

    ๐Ÿ’ FAQ

    Q1: How long does DAM system migration typically take?

    Quick Answer: Medium enterprises typically need 2-4 weeks; large enterprises should adopt phased migration with overall 6-8 week cycles.

    Operational Checklist:

    1. Week 1: Complete asset inventory and risk assessment
    2. Week 2: Begin low-risk material migration and permission testing
    3. Week 3: Core business material migration and parallel validation
    4. Week 4: Full switchover and issue resolution


    Q2: How to avoid data loss during migration?

    Core Strategy: Conduct comprehensive asset inventory in advance, choose DAM platforms supporting enterprise-grade encrypted transmission and version management.

    Loss Prevention Checklist:

    • Establish complete pre-migration data backup
    • Enable encrypted transmission protocols
    • Verify metadata and tag completeness
    • Set real-time migration monitoring
    • Prepare data rollback emergency plans


    Q3: Do teams need to stop working to complete migration?

    Answer: Absolutely not. Through dual-system parallel operation and temporary access channels, teams can achieve "seamless migration."

    Reference Steps:

    • Maintain old system availability
    • Open partial new system permissions
    • Unified transfer after completion


    Q4: How to determine if migration is successful?

    Assessment: Look beyond technical metrics to business experience. Successful migration should make teams feel efficiency improvements, not adaptation pain.

    Success Assessment Checklist:

    • Data Integrity: 100% complete migration of materials and metadata
    • Permission Accuracy: Team access permissions perfectly match business needs
    • Business Fluency: Daily work efficiency improves rather than declines
    • User Satisfaction: Positive team feedback with manageable learning costs
    • Long-term ROI: Efficiency or cost advantages evident within 3 months post-migration


    Q5: What are the migration focus differences across industries?

    E-commerce/Retail Industry:

    • Prioritize high availability of product images and marketing materials
    • Focus on access stability during seasonal promotional periods
    • Establish linkage between product lifecycle and material management

    Media/Advertising Industry:

    • Strengthen version control and creative asset collaboration processes
    • Set independent permission management for client project assets
    • Establish material usage tracking and copyright protection mechanisms
